Skier’s death reported at new Wasatch Peaks Ranch ski resort

By Mark Shenefelt - | Jan 10, 2023

Photo supplied, Wasatch Peaks Ranch

This undated photo shows a portion of the Wasatch Peaks Ranch private ski resort development area in Morgan County.

PETERSON — Investigators are awaiting a medical examiner’s report to determine the cause of a 38-year-old skier’s death after a crash during a run Sunday at the private Wasatch Peaks Ranch resort.

Sgt. Todd Christensen of the Morgan County Sheriff’s Office said Tuesday the man, a Salt Lake City resident, was skiing with friends at about 2:45 p.m. Sunday when he hit a snow berm that caused him to crash.

The cause of death is being investigated as an accidental crash, Christensen said. The man had no obvious external injuries and may have had a medical issue, so the body was sent to the state medical examiner’s office, he said.

The resort issued a statement about the incident:

“Wasatch Peaks Ranch regretfully confirms a tragic incident which took place on the mountain today involving a 38-year old man from Salt Lake City.

“The guest was transported off the mountain and transferred to Morgan County EMS. He was pronounced deceased while being transported to the hospital.

“Wasatch Peaks Ranch, our Ski Patrol and our entire staff extend our deepest sympathy and support to our guest’s family and friends.”
